Course Details
• Advanced Crowdfunding Tax Planning: This unit will cover the advanced tax planning strategies specifically for high-growth companies using crowdfunding as a source of capital. It will include topics such as equity crowdfunding, reward-based crowdfunding, and tax implications for both the company and the investors.
• Federal Tax Laws and Regulations: This unit will cover the federal tax laws and regulations that apply to crowdfunding for high-growth companies. It will include topics such as income tax, employment tax, and excise tax.
• State and Local Tax Considerations: This unit will cover the state and local tax considerations for high-growth companies using crowdfunding as a source of capital. It will include topics such as sales tax, use tax, and property tax.
• Tax Compliance for Crowdfunding Campaigns: This unit will cover the tax compliance requirements for crowdfunding campaigns, including the proper reporting and filing of taxes.
• Tax Implications of Equity Crowdfunding: This unit will cover the tax implications of equity crowdfunding, including the treatment of securities, the taxation of crowdfunding investors, and the taxation of crowdfunding platforms.
• Tax Implications of Reward-Based Crowdfunding: This unit will cover the tax implications of reward-based crowdfunding, including the treatment of contributions, the taxation of rewards, and the taxation of crowdfunding platforms.
• Tax Planning Strategies for High-Growth Companies: This unit will cover the tax planning strategies that high-growth companies can use to minimize their tax liability and optimize their after-tax profit.
• Tax Audits and Controversies: This unit will cover the tax audits and controversies that high-growth companies using crowdfunding as a source of capital may face, including the handling of disputes, the resolution of tax controversies, and the management of tax audits.
